nsm Prestige es160 carriage
I recently bought a Prestige ES160, the manual I have unfortunately is
for an es II 160. They seem to be almost identical, but I'm not sure. The question I have is, in the manual it shows a switch to indicate when the carriage has reached the far left and right position, this switch I guess switches the carriage from playing a sides to b sides at the end of it's travel. My carriage does not have anything that looks like what is picured in the manual. The manual says that the switch will reverse the motor to move back to the right. If there is a missing switch, I don't see anyplace where a switch would be wired to. Does anyone have this same box that could take some pictured of their carriage and send to me?
